Scent and Air Quality Optimization

Your olfactory system connects directly to the limbic brain, making scent one of the most powerful tools for environmental mood control. Air quality and intentional aromatherapy can instantly shift your psychological state.

Research from the International Journal of Environmental Research shows that improved air quality increases cognitive performance by 15% while strategic scenting enhances mood and reduces anxiety.

Atmospheric Living 2026: Environmental Mood Mastery - Complete Guide to Space Design Psychology - Image 3

Air Quality Fundamentals

Clean air is essential for optimal brain function. Poor indoor air quality causes fatigue, headaches, and decreased mental clarity.

Key air quality factors include:

  • Humidity levels: Maintain 40-60% relative humidity for comfort and health
  • Ventilation: Ensure adequate fresh air circulation to prevent CO2 buildup
  • Pollutant removal: Use plants, air purifiers, or natural ventilation to eliminate toxins
  • Temperature control: Keep temperatures between 68-72°F for optimal cognitive performance

Lighting for Circadian and Mood Enhancement

Lighting profoundly influences your circadian rhythm, hormone production, and psychological well-being. Modern atmospheric design leverages lighting science to optimize both biological and emotional responses.

Research demonstrates that proper lighting can improve sleep quality by 37%, increase productivity by 23%, and reduce seasonal depression symptoms by 42%.

Circadian Lighting Principles

Your body's internal clock responds to light intensity and color temperature throughout the day. Aligning artificial lighting with natural patterns supports optimal physiological function.

Morning Light (6 AM - 10 AM): Bright, cool light (5000-6500K) suppresses melatonin and increases alertness. Position bright lights in morning activity areas.

Midday Light (10 AM - 4 PM): Maximum brightness with neutral white light (4000-5000K) supports sustained attention and energy levels.

Evening Light (4 PM - 10 PM): Gradually dim lights and shift toward warmer tones (2700-3000K) to prepare for rest.

Night Light (10 PM onwards): Minimal lighting with warm, red-shifted spectrum to avoid melatonin suppression.

Task-Specific Lighting Design

Different activities require specific lighting conditions for optimal performance and comfort. Spatial wellness considers both functional and psychological lighting needs.

Reading and Detail Work: 500-1000 lux of neutral white light positioned to avoid glare and shadows.

Computer Work: Balanced ambient and task lighting to reduce screen contrast and eye strain.

Creative Activities: Variable lighting options including warm accent lights to stimulate imagination.

Relaxation: Dim, warm lighting under 200 lux to promote calm and stress reduction.
